Interesting Questions, Facts, and Information

    Rat Pack

    The name 'Rat Pack' was the name often used by others when referring to this group. What was the name the group members called themselves? (Hint: This name was inspired by a meeting of world leaders, i.e., a ________ conference.)Rat Pack, part 1

      The Summit. The name 'Summit' came from the 'Summit at the Sands,' held from Jan. 26 through Feb. 16, 1960, playing on a summit meeting in Paris between U.S. President Eisenhower, Russian leader Nikita Khrushchev and French President Charles De Gaulle.

    At what Las Vegas hotel did they usually perform? (Hint: This casino was imploded in 1996 to make way for the Venetian.)Rat Pack, part 1

      Sands. The Copa Room in the Sands Hotel in Las Vegas was 'home' to the Rat Pack. The Sands was opened in 1952 and was imploded in 1996 to make room for a new Las Vegas hotel, the Venetian.

    What was the first movie all five Rat Pack members appeared in together? (Hint: The plot is about a scheme to rob five casinos. It was remade as a 2001 movie starring George Clooney, Brad Pitt, Andy Garcia, and Julia Roberts, but in the remake only three casinos were robbed.) Rat Pack, part 1

      Ocean's Eleven. The original 'Ocean's Eleven' was released in 1960 and it starred all five Rat Pack members. The plot involved eleven friends who know each other from their World War II service days who plan to rob five of the biggest casinos in Las Vegas in one night.

    Which Rat Pack member frequently went into the casino itself and dealt blackjack? (Hint: As a young man he worked as a blackjack dealer in the back room of an Ohio store.)Rat Pack, part 1

      Dean Martin. Martin was actually a pretty good dealer. In his younger days he was employed as a blackjack dealer in the back room of the Rex Cigar Store in Steubenville, Ohio. Frank Sinatra was also said to deal blackjack occasionally.

    Who is generally credited with originating the name "Rat Pack"? (Hint: She was married to Humphrey Bogart and she acted with him in the movies "Key Largo" and "To Have and Have Not.") Rat Pack, part 1

      Lauren Bacall. Lauren Bacall first coined the term "Rat Pack" in the early 1950s to describe the Hollywood drinking circle that included legendary boozers such as her husband Humphrey Bogart, Sinatra, Judy Garland and Swifty Lazar (she first called them "a pack of rats" when she saw the drunken crew).

    How many times was Frank Sinatra married? (Hint: Think about his relationships with Nancy, Ava, Mia and Barbara.)Rat Pack, part 1

      4. Sinatra was single (divorced) during the prime Rat Pack years. He was married four times over his lifetime (1915-1998). His wives were Nancy Barbato (married in 1939, divorced 1951), Ava Gardner (married in 1951, divorced 1957), Mia Farrow (married in 1966, divorced 1967), and Barbara Marx (married in 1976). He remained married to Barbara until his death in May 1998 at age 82. Nancy Barbato is the mother of his three children.

    True or false? Frank Sinatra said on the subject of Dean Martin's drinking, "I spill more than he drinks." (Hint: Martin had an image as a heavy drinker.) Rat Pack, part 1

      True. Although Dean Martin's drinking was a running joke in the Rat Pack's performances, Martin's son Ricci says in his recent memoir that what appeared to be scotch in his dad's glass onstage was actually usually tea or apple juice.

    The character Johnny Fontane in the movie "The Godfather" (the wedding singer played by Al Martino) was patterned after which Rat Pack member? (Hint: He was in the movie "From Here to Eternity.") Rat Pack, part 1

      Frank Sinatra. The scene in which Jack Wolz (the movie producer who got the horse head in his bed) said "Johnny Fontane never gets that movie! That part is perfect for him, it'll make him a big star, and I'm gonna run him out of the business, and let me tell you why" was in reference to Sinatra playing Private Maggio in the movie "From Here to Eternity" (and winning an Academy Award for his performance).

    Who came up with the name Rat Pack?The Rat Pack

      Lauren Bacall. The group originally sprung up around Humphrey Bogart, whose wife Lauren Bacall first named them. Seeing Bogie, Frank and a few of their cronies come straggling in from a night of carousing, Lauren exclaimed, "You look like a goddamned Rat Pack!" The name stuck.

    What was Dean Martin’s nickname within the group?The Rat Pack

      Dag. Sammy’s nickname was Smokey.

    What Las Vegas hotel did they hold their famous Summit meetings?The Rat Pack

      Sands Hotel and Casino. Sadly, the Sands no longer exists. It was a casualty of Las Vegas' expansion and the trend toward family entertainment. For a period of time in the early-to-mid sixties, though, it was the coolest spot in the Universe.

    Which female actress was an honorary member?The Rat Pack

      Shirley Maclaine. She was their mascot and Girl Friday. She also starred in “Some Came Running” with Sinatra and Martin.

    Who was Peter Lawford’s very famous brother in law?The Rat Pack

      John F. Kennedy. He was married to JFK’s sister Pat and all of the Rat Pack supported his 1960 campaign to reach the White House.

    Dean Martin is so closely tied to the Rat Pack it is easy to forget that he was once part of a very famous comedy duo. Who was his partner?The Rat Pack

      Jerry Lewis. It was after they split that Martin hooked up with Sinatra and became the packs unofficial Vice Chairman.

    Which song did Frank and Sammy sing together on stage, which joked about Sammy’s colour?The Rat Pack

      Me and My Shadow. Their chummy friendship was considered quite daring for the era.

    Which Rat Packer photographed the cover picture for "Life" magazine of the Ali - Frazier fight in 1971?The Rat Pack

      Frank Sinatra . He was credited with being the offcial photographer for that assignment.

    What was the nationality of Sammy’s wife May Britt?The Rat Pack

      Swedish. She was the only wife to disapprove of the Rat Pack.

    Rat Pack member Peter Lawford had what connection to U.S. Senator (and future U.S. President) John F. Kennedy? (Hint: JFK had five sisters.) Rat Pack, part 2

      brother in law. Lawford was married to Pat Kennedy, one of the sisters of John F. Kennedy. Frank Sinatra had a falling out in 1961 with Lawford over his brother-in-law Robert Kennedy’s (then U.S. Attorney General) objections to Sinatra’s alleged Mafia connections, and the two men never spoke again.

    Who was the shortest member of the Rat Pack? (Hint: He was 5' 3" tall.) Rat Pack, part 2

      Sammy Davis, Jr.. Sammy Davis, Jr. was 5' 3", Joey Bishop was 5' 7", Frank Sinatra was 5' 8", Dean Martin was 6' (or 5' 11" from another source), and Peter Lawford was 6'.

    Which Rat Pack member adapted (and recorded) a movie song as a campaign song for John F. Kennedy's 1960 campaign for U.S. President? (Hint: He founded Reprise Records in 1961.) Rat Pack, part 2

      Frank Sinatra. Frank Sinatra adapted and recorded a special version of the tune "High Hopes" as a campaign song for Kennedy's 1960 U.S. Presidential campaign ("…Jack is on the right track, 'cause he has high hopes…"). The song "High Hopes" had originally been in Sinatra's 1959 film "A Hole in the Head" (Sammy Cahn and Jimmy Van Heusen co-won an Oscar for it). They both later worked on the original 1960 version of the movie "Ocean's Eleven."

    Who was the honorary mascot of the Rat Pack? (Hint: Her younger brother is Warren Beatty.) Rat Pack, part 2

      Shirley MacLaine. At the opening of the U.S. Democratic Party National Convention in Los Angeles in 1960, Frank, Sammy, Peter, and Shirley MacLaine sang "The Star-Spangled Banner." She also had a small bit part in the 1960 movie "Ocean's Eleven," in which all five Rat Pack members appeared.

    What was the nickname used onstage for Sammy Davis, Jr.? (Hint: Sammy usually smoked four packs of cigarettes a day during his lifetime.) Rat Pack, part 2

      Smokey. Davis and his good friend Sinatra frequently sang a duet onstage with the song "Me and My Shadow." They met in 1941 at Detroit's Michigan Theater when the vaudeville troupe the Mastin Gang (featuring Sammy Davis, Jr.) opened for the Tommy Dorsey dance band (with their vocalist Frank Sinatra). They remained lifelong friends.

    How did Sammy Davis, Jr. lose his eye? (Hint: This happened between Las Vegas and Los Angeles.) Rat Pack, part 2

      automobile accident. In 1954, Sammy lost his left eye in a near-fatal car crash while driving from Las Vegas to Los Angeles. He wore an eye patch for awhile, but Humphrey Bogart ultimately convinced him to forgo it. He used a glass eye from then on for the rest of his life.
